Build a Nutritious Diet Plan



Without proper nutrition, even the most intense workout plan won't be effective.

Aim for foods that support fat loss:
- Colorful, fiber-rich produce
- Lean proteins such as chicken, fish, tofu
- Healthy fats like avocado, nuts, and olive oil
- Brown rice, oats, quinoa

Drink plenty of water and limit sugary drinks.

Exercise Smart and Regularly



Physical activity improves overall health, but more importantly, it helps maintain weight loss.

- Balance endurance with resistance exercises
-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ate activity per week
- Try activities you enjoy: dancing, hiking, cycling, swimming

Recovery is just as important as training.
